The Tahiti GPU has 4.31 billion transistors on a 365 mm² silicon wafer. Cape Verde has 1.5 billion transistors on a 123mm2 wafer. In its most complete configuration, implemented in the Radeon HD 7770 model, this GPU includes 10 Compute Units (CUs), each of which consists of four Vector Units (VUs). In turn, each vector block consists of 16 stream processors, which gives a total of 640 stream processors (shaders) based on the Graphics Core Next architecture.

Cape Verde has four raster operations units (ROPs) - exactly half of what is available in Tahiti, this provides 16 raster operations per cycle. Two 64-bit memory controllers are connected to rasterizers via a common interface. Thus, we get a 128-bit memory bus.

 Radeon HD 7770 Specifications 

Name Radeon HD 7770
Core Cape Verde
Process technology (µm) 0.028
Transistors (million) 1500
Core frequency 1000
Memory frequency (DDR) 4500
Bus and memory type GDDR5 128-bit
Bandwidth (Gb/s) 72
Unified shader blocks 640
Frequency of unified shader units 1000
TMU per conveyor 40
ROP 16
Fill Rate (Mpix/s) 16000
Fill Rate (Mtex/s) 40000
DirectX 11.1
Memory 1024
Interface PCI-E 3.0 x16

Officially, the top card on the Cape Verde GPU is called the Radeon HD 7770 GHz Edition, which indicates a GPU frequency of one gigahertz. This is an important point, according to AMD, as each vendor will list "1 GHz" on their card's packaging, whether they use a reference board design or a "performance" model that has an original cooling system. Of course, we all know that the core frequency is only one of the components that affect the performance of a video card.

The Radeon HD 7770 1 GHz uses all 640 stream processors available for the Cape Verde core, which theoretically delivers 1.28 teraflops of compute performance. Each CU has four texture processing units, and their total number in the Radeon HD 7770 1 GHz reaches 40. Four ROPs are connected via a common interface to two 64-bit memory controllers. Thus, we have a 128-bit memory bus combined with 1 GB of GDDR5 graphics memory running at 1125 MHz.
